Output c28c8865ffafa3cb91e9f7f853d75437d8859a58dc981afb2f56148e79461b19:0

value
22898496
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2c9c156738da0f241c5e4db51e2e41f4e25dec20bd89622b41fca519a8a9e209
address
tb1p9jwp2eecmg8jg8z7fk63utjp7n39mmpqhkyky26pljj3n29fugysdfmw89
transaction
c28c8865ffafa3cb91e9f7f853d75437d8859a58dc981afb2f56148e79461b19
confirmations
14360
spent
true